How do you measure a cup of lard?

If you’re using a solid fat such as margarine, lard, buttery spread, or shortening that comes in a tub, measure it by scooping it into the measuring cup/spoon and smoothing it out.

Can you replace lard with butter?

Butter is perhaps the most straightforward alternative for lard. Butter, when used in conjunction with modest alterations to your recipe, may aid in the preservation of the taste and texture of your finished product. As a result, butter is an excellent choice for pie crusts, tortillas, tamale dough, and other baked goods.

What measuring cup do you use for shortening?

Using a spatula, compact the shortening into a dry measuring cup, making sure there are no air pockets in the shortening mixture. Using a metal spatula or the flat side of a knife, bring the rim up to the desired level. Some shortenings are sold in sticks and may be measured in the same way as butter.

Is Tenderflake lard hydrogenated?

This is the first time in the history of the Canadian retail sector that a lard has been labeled as ″non-hydrogenated.″ ‘Tenderflake lard is a 100% pure animal product and not a shortening,’ explains Colin Farnum, head of research and development at Maple Leaf Foods, which is responsible for the Tenderflake brand.
